- As many as 66 challans were issued and 15 schoolbuses impounded under the Safe School Vehicle Scheme in Kapurthala on Monday evening.
- Kapurthala Deputy Commissioner Dipti Uppal said vehicles used for ferrying students should be painted yellow.
- All buses should prominently display the name of the school, telephone numbers of the school and the transport officer on the front and at the rear.
- Also, the vehicles should have a first-aid box, fire extinguisher and an emergency door.
- These should not be older than 15 years and must have women attendants and CCTVs cameras. Drivers and conductors should be in proper uniform
- Phagwara SDM Gurvinder Singh Johal issued 34 challans and impounded 13 buses. Kapurthala SDM Varinder Pal Singh Bajwa challaned eight buses.OC
